1865-72 1r Yellow, Imperforate on Wove Paper, (Third Period)

Lot 5160 ()   

Ecuador, 1865, 1r Yellow Buff, Horizontal Strip of Nine and Single, strip positions 19-27, all canceled by fancy "Chimbo" flower circular handstamps prior to being applied to Judicial front to Guaranda, positions 23-24 in strip also show portion of previous manuscript, manuscript "19½ oz" weight endorsement at top, F.-V.F., a rare Postal Fraud usage of the 1r yellow issue, one of two such first issue postal fraud usage known, ex-Saá and Longhi.
Scott No. 4    Estimate $1,500 - 2,000.

This cover was part of the Saá collection in Ecuador after its find in an Ecuadorian archive. It was subsequently sold to Florenzo Longhi in Italy.
